Whether you've been running a multinational for years or you've just been promoted to your very first management position, you are likely mindful that there are some essential business management skills that are essential to the role. For instance, project management abilities need to be on point as managers will be required to manage a number of jobs at once. This indicates that you ought to deal with your time and . resource management to make sure that all projects are delivered in a prompt way. Another essential ability you need to develop is workers management. This will permit you to draw out the most value possible out of your staff members without overworking them. Some crucial responsibilities in this context include setting clear objectives for each worker, helping with personal and professional development, and designating tasks based on skillset and proficiency. If you have actually been promoted to a management position and are still learning the ropes, among the very best business management tips you can get is to develop a cohesive and high performing group. If you're given the opportunity to assemble your own group and have some agency over hiring, you must intend to hire experts from different backgrounds and skillsets to guarantee that all your bases are covered. Another crucial element to consider is whether candidates fit in with the company culture and your own vision. This will maximise the possibilities of success and permit a smoother integration into the business. If you will be managing a pre-existing group, you need to focus more on teambuilding activities in order to develop a favourable and collaborative work environment.
